"表单的组成-DHTML样式表编写"
在网页设计中,表单扮演着至关重要的角色,它允许用户向服务器提交数据。表单的组成部分主要包含两大部分:一是描述表单元素的HTML源代码,这些代码定义了表单的布局、控件类型以及用户交互方式;二是客户端的脚本,如JavaScript,或者服务器端处理用户输入信息的程序,如PHP、ASP等。表单通常包括单行输入框、多行输入框、单选按钮和复选框等多种形式,以满足不同类型的用户输入需求。
DHTML(Dynamic HTML)是动态HTML的简称,它是指通过结合HTML、CSS、JavaScript和DOM(Document Object Model)来创建具有动态效果的网页技术。与静态网站相比,动态网站的内容不是固定的,而是由服务器动态生成HTML文档,能够根据用户交互或数据库信息实时更新。这使得网站更加互动和个性化。
在应用程序开发体系中,常见的结构有两种:B/S(Browser/Server,浏览器/服务器)和C/S(Client/Server,客户端/服务器)。B/S结构中,客户端主要使用HTML、CSS和JavaScript等技术,而服务器端则可能使用ASP.NET、PHP或JSP等服务器端语言。C/S结构则涉及到更复杂的客户端应用,如VB、VC#或Java,通常需要安装额外的客户端软件,并且数据库支持多样,包括SQL Server、Oracle等。
HTML(HyperText Markup Language)是用于创建网页的标准标记语言。HTML4.0是其一个版本,用于定义网页的结构和内容。编写HTML文档有三种常见方式:手写HTML代码,使用可视化编辑器如Frontpage或Dreamweaver,或者通过服务器端动态生成。在命名HTML文件时,通常使用.htm或.html扩展名,避免空格和特殊字符,仅使用下划线,并区分大小写。首页文件名通常是index.htm或index.html。
HTML文件的基本结构包括<html>、<head>和<body>三个主要部分。<head>中包含文档元信息,如<title>定义网页标题,<meta>定义元数据;<body>则是HTML文件的正文,包含所有可见内容。HTML中的每个元素(element)都是构成网页的基本单元,元素之间存在嵌套关系,共同构建出网页的结构和表现。